Electronics For Imaging, Inc. (EFI) reported that Paris-based print business DécoAder has installed the 800th new generation EFI industrial roll-to-roll printer. DécoAder selected the 5.2-meter-wide EFI VUTEk Q5r roll-to-roll LED printer to grow its existing fleet’s capabilities, ensure high quality, increase output, and maintain a competitive edge over other SME digital print providers.
“We have never seen a printer with such technological development on the market before, and it far exceeds the capabilities of those already in use,” said Thierry Borrat, DécoAder’s CEO. The VUTEk Q5r will help to meet the company’s customers’ needs in a variety of markets, but espe-cially those within the event and vehicular print sectors.
Founded in 1972, DécoAder gradually adopted digital printing to become a leading large-format print business in France. It employs 75 people and already houses four EFI VUTEk UV LED printers on its shop floor.
Managed since 2009 by Borrat and Christelle Meyer, DécoAder offers its clients a comprehensive range of services, and supports them throughout their projects right up to installation. In recent years, the business has experienced increased demand for faster turnaround times and higher-volume orders, while aiming to improve efficiency, minimise waste and increase their focus on sustainability.
“The selection of the Q5r guarantees us high productivity and a capacity to print significant vol-umes quickly,” said Borrat. “It allows us to meet the expectations of our customers, who approach us with very tight deadlines, especially in the events sector. The Q5r provides the necessary flexi-bility and comfort to respond to higher-volume markets.”
The EFI VUTEk Q5r printer is capable of running at speeds of up to 672 square meters per hour. It is available with four colors plus optional light colors, white, and a new UltraClear Coat for even more design and application possibilities.
The printer features EFI UltraDropTM Technology with native 7-picolitre printheads and multi-drop addressability for high-definition quality. Benefits include smoothness in shadows, gradients, and transitions, as well as precise and sharp four-point sized text with a true resolution of up to 1,200 dots per inch.
"The economic model of our trade is changing,” said Borrat. “There are lots of challenges, but they are essentially based on pricing and the environment. The option of coating and cutting in-line ena-bles us to once again compete in markets where there is a lot of fierce competition."
DécoAder’s new printer is capable of printing both white and clear together inline. White printing with a variety of multi-layer modes – plus the UltraClear Coat in glossy and matte modes with se-lective or full flood application for protection or design enhancement – enable DécoAder to expand creative possibilities in construction, interior design and personalixed jobs.
“This printer has opened new horizons for us and will enable us to offer our services with a crea-tive bonus and distinct added value at an extremely competitive price,” said Borrat.
In 2021, the EFI VUTEk Q5r roll-to-roll LED printer was recognized for its standout capabilities in the European Digital Press (EDP) Awards, beating out its competitors to receive the award in the large/wide-format printing systems category for printers above 350 centimeters wide.
